Q: What is the formula used for calculating cylinder surface area?

A: The calculator uses the standard mathematical formula: Total Surface Area = 2πr(r + h), where 'r' is the radius of the circular base and 'h' is the height of the cylinder. This formula accounts for both the curved surface area and the areas of the two circular bases.

Q: What if I need to calculate for a cylinder without one base?

A: Our calculator provides the total surface area including both bases. If you need the surface area for a cylinder with one base open (like a cup), simply subtract the area of one base from the result. The area of one circular base is πr².
